So what did I do while sick?? I watched movies, lots of movies, and I thought - why not make a list of my favorites??

So here are three lists, one about what to watch with your boyfriend or husband, then with your girls, and lastly, with the family. Here they are below:

So, here are three types of movies, based on what my boyfriend and I have actually watched and enjoyed. Superhero movies are always a good choice, but the best? The Dark Knight, hands down.

Dark movies not your thing for those cozy days? Go for his funny bone then, and laugh out with this male-targeted comedy, called The Watch. It's lewd and funny - your boy will enjoy it, I promise. And after the testosterone fest, then maybe he'll agree to a rom-com for you. Crazy, Stupid Love is one of the only rom coms Leon and I watched together without him falling asleep - he actually recommended it to me. It's a great, light movie with lots of love and laughs.

The Runner Ups: Life of Pi//Inception//Three Idiots (Indian movie - so make sure to get a copy with subtitles)//Twilight?? Hahaha.

Okay, so maybe the boyfriend's busy, so you call your girls for a sleepover, or just a hang out session. With my friends - here are what I watched:

Finally, a lewd comedy for girls - we laughed out with this movie (though we didn't plan our weddings at the same time). Not your thing? Then a little horror with all your girls. Sorority Row was about a group of girls, and my friends and I couldn't help identifying who was who...I ended up being the nerdy girl. Pfft. 

And lastly, another superhero movie (because we all love superhero movies right?). I chose The Avengers specifically because of all the male eye-candy. Not something you'd like to be gushing out to your significant other, but with your girls? Haha, you can watch all the action, all the while comparing who - Thor vs Captain America vs Iron Man - has the best abs. I go for Thor! =)

Runner Ups: The Hangover//The Ugly Truth//Twilight//Gossip Girl (TV Show)

Finally, for those days in with your siblings and parents. I have three sisters who I watch everything with. I guess it will all come down to how old they are. If you're an only child, don't worry, these movies are all great anyway. So for the last list, here are my movies:

If you have younger siblings, cartoons are the best bet. Despicable Me is one of my favorites. It is a great cartoon, with cute minions. If your siblings are older, like mine, then I'm pretty sure you'd get a kick out of scary movies. No one likes to annoy me more after a horror movie like my sisters. Insidious is a great starter, because for all intents and purposes it's not actually scary, but it is! 

And finally, nothing is more effortless than a movie based on popular fiction. Chances are your siblings will already know it, and the setting will be very familiar. I didn't put Harry Potter on here, because since I was the only one who read it, I had to explain everything every five minutes. The Hunger Games is easy enough to understand.

Runner-Ups: Castle (TV Show)//How to Train Your Dragon//Megamind//Harry Potter//Paranormal Activity
